I am trying to figure out how to have multiple featured images on our main site that rotate or cycle from picture to picture.
December 9, 2020 at 10:51 am #1573285Leo
StaffCustomer SupportHi there,
The featured image option is a core WordPress option and it only allows 1 featured image per page/post.
I believe you’d need a slider plugin for what you are looking for.
